I like all Richard Hawley's albums, but continuing with the 'reverse' theme, I would suggest starting with his latest album: Hollow Meadows. As I said in my previous message, I think it's a cracking album, and the penultimate track, Heart of Oak just rocks! Although it's his latest album, I think it would make a great introduction to his work.

His previous album, Standing at the Sky's Edge, is his loudest, angry album so to speak. By contrast, his 2005 Coles Corner, is a genuinely gorgeous affair.
